And What is Application Lifecycle Management?

The application life cycle management (ALM) tool market

is focused on the planning and governance activities of

the software development life cycle (SDLC). Traditionally,

this has been the combination of software change and

configuration management (SCCM), requirements management and quality management. [Gartner]

Application Lifecycle Management

(ALM) is a continuous process of

managing the life of an application

through governance, development

and maintenance. ALM is the

marriage of business management

to software engineering made

possible by tools that facilitate and

integrate requirements

management, architecture, coding,

testing, tracking, and release

management. [Wikipedia]…an application’s lifecycle

includes the entire time during

which an organization is spending

money on this asset, from the

initial idea to the end of the

application’s life.

[Chappell & Associates]

…to mange an entire

development project on a

unified basis, from requirements formation

all the way to sending

that thing out the door…

[Jeff Feinman, SD Times]

10. Provides an Enterprise View

• What:– Provides a consistent and meaningful view of

development project work and status

• Why:– Provide decision makers with:

• A current view of development project investments• A consistent view between disparate teams and projects• Information supporting future investment decisions

• How:– Standard processes and terminology– Automatic collection of metrics– Consolidated metrics repository

9. Enhances Team Satisfaction

• What:– Improves satisfaction of development team

with their role in the organization.

• Why:– Improved morale reduces turnover and associated costs– Happy employees are more productive– Motivated employees are more likely to make their own

investments in an organization

• How:– Make teams part of the business and visa versa– Empower development teams to make a difference– Invest in tools and processes that acknowledge team value

8. Reduces Risk

• What:– Provides the information needed to identify,

understand, track and mitigate development risks

• Why:– Minimize unexpected ‘surprises’– Reduce costly mistakes– Improves release consistency and quality

• How:– Monitor project status from all angles– Identify trends– Proactively manage risks– Adopt iterative development practices

7. Improves Resource Utilization

• What:– Allows more efficient workflow for team members

(Less time ‘thrashing’ and more time delivering)– Supports better usage of development systems

(e.g., development and test environments)

• Why:– Increases business value delivered without increasing costs

• How:– Adopt a continuous improvement mindset– Visualize your workflow and monitor work in progress– Use modern best practices and tools to improve efficiency– Use virtualization to improve dev/test system utilization

6. Reduces Delivery Cycle Time

• What:– Decrease the time it takes for the team to deliver

an application release

• Why:– Increase the flow of business value– Improve the potential for stakeholder feedback

• How:– Use agile/lean practices to provide a continuous flow of value– Reduce churn from misunderstood requirements– Use tools to automate mundane delivery processes

5. Minimizes Downtime

• What:– Reduce the Mean Time To Repair (MTTR) for

feedback reported from a production environment

• Why:– Down time is costly!– Dissatisfied users

• How:– Close the gap between development and operations– Capture meaningful diagnostic data in production– Use tools to streamline communications

4. Increases Responsiveness

• What:– Improve the ability for the team to respond to

requests– Streamline communications at all levels of the

application lifecycle

• Why:– Drive delivery of business value based on current needs– Reduce MTTR for defects

• How:– Maintain a consistent backlog with meaningful priorities– Use processes and tools to improve communications with

stakeholders and operations– Ensure teams have committed stakeholder involvement

3. Improves Efficiency

• What:– Reduce the time, effort and cost associated with

processes that do not add value

• Why:– Reducing waste has the side effect of improving efficiency– Managing the lifecycle enables waste reduction

• How:– Model current workflow practices – Visualize work in progress and determine limits– Invest in ongoing process improvement– Adopt modern best practices and tools

2. Reduces Development Costs

• What:– Spend less money to achieve equivalent

or better results

• Why:– Improve profitability– Free up resources to address additional business needs

• How:– Adopt ALM tools and practices to

• …improve efficiency, quality, responsiveness and resource utilization and

• …reduce cycle time and risk.

$

1. Maximizes Stakeholder Satisfaction

• What:– Understand and anticipate business needs– Deliver what is needed on time and within budget

• Why:– Satisfied stakeholders indicate that application development

is successfully supporting the business

• How:– Consistent and frequent feedback from stakeholder(s)– Correct course as needed to ensure application meets needs– Embrace application quality– Foster open and transparent communications with the

business
